  • Spatial and temporal characteristics of nitrate contamination and hydrogeochemical parameters were investigated for springs and surficial and bedrock groundwaters in northeastern part of Hongseong. Two field investigations were conducted at dry and wet seasons in 2011 for 120 sites including measurement of field parameters with chemical analyses of major dissolved constituents. Nitrate concentrations were at background levels in springs while 45% of bedrock groundwater and 49% of surficial groundwater exceeded the drinking water standard of nitrate (10 mg/L as $NO_3$-N). The difference in nitrate concentrations between surficial and bedrock groundwater was statistically insignificant. Cumulative frequency distribution of nitrate concentrations revealed two inflection points of 2 and 16 mg/L as $NO_3$-N. Correlation analysis of hydrogeochemical parameters showed that nitrate had higher correlations with Sr, Mg, Cl, Na, and Ca, in surficial groundwater in both dry and wet season. In contrast, nitrate had much weaker correlations with other hydrogeochemical parameters in bedrock groundwater compared to surficial groundwater and had significant correlations only in wet season. Temporally, nitrate and chloride concentrations decreased and dissolved oxygen (DO) increased from dry season to wet season, which indicates that increased recharge during the wet season affected groundwater quality. Aerobic conditions were predominant for both surficial and bedrock groundwater indicating low natural attenuation potential of nitrate in the aquifers of the study area.

  • The regional distribution and relative frequency of gastrointestinal endocrine cells were studied immunohistochemically in the gastrointestinal mucosa and pancreas of the fresh water turtle. Ten kinds of endocrine cells were identified in the gastrointestinal tract. Cholecystokinin-8-, bovine pancreatic polypetide-and glucagon-immunoreactive cells were seen throughout the gastrointestinal tract, also among them cholecystokinin-8-immunoreactive cells were most predominant in segment III. Although gastrin- and gastrin/cholecystokinin-immunoreactive cells were found from segment III to VI and X, respectively, they were numerous in segment III. Somatostatin-immunoreactive cells were observed from segment I to VII. 5-hydroxytryptamine- immunoreactive cells were detected in segment I, III, VIII, IX and X. Human pancreatic polypeptide-immunoreactive cells were demonstrated in segment V, VI, VIII, IX and X. Insulin-immunoreactive cells were found from segment III to X except for segment VIII, but rare in segment VII. Neurotensin-immunoreactive cells were found to be restricted to segment VIII, IX and X. No porcine chromogranin-, substance P- and bombesin-immunoreactive cells were detected throughout the gastrointestinal tract of the fresh water turtle. Although typical mammalian pancreatic islets encapsulated by connective tissue were not present in this species, five kinds of endocrine cells-glucagon, insulin, somatostatin, bovine pancreatic polypeptide and 5-hydroxytryptamine-were found in forming small or large groups and scattered in the exocrine gland region. However porcine chromogranin- and motilin-immunoreactive cells could not be demonstrated in the pancreas.

  • A total of 18 Newcastle disease virus (NDV) isolates that were recovered from 1949 through 1997 were characterized and pathotyped. All viruses were highly virulent as determined by intracerebral pathogenicity indices ${\geq}1.81$ in day-old. These pathotypes are typical for viscerotropic velogenic NDV (VVNDV) pathotype viruses. Some differences were observed for the chicken red blood cell elution rate and thermostability of the hemagglutinin at $56^{\circ}C$. Three antigenic groups were identified by a hemagglutination-inhibition assay using NDV monoclonal antibodies. And the predominant gross lesions were as follows: discharge from the nasal cavity, tracheal mucus, petechial hemorrhage in the heart fat, kidney urates and hemorrhage with or without necrosis in the gastrointestinal tract. Severe hemorrhagic or necrotic lesions were also noted in the lymphoid organs and were localized primarily in the spleen and cecal tonsil. However, differences in the occurrence and frequency of the gross lesions were observed between the virus strains. Among them, NDV strains that induced neurological symptoms belonged only to genotype VI. This strain had spread throughout Korea during the late 1980s to the 1990s, which suggests that specific VVNDVs genotypes might result in neurological symptoms.

  • Using polyacrylamide-gel isoelectric focusing followed by immunoblotting, genetic polymorphism of plasma vitamin D-binding protein (Gc) was examined in Asian sheep. The Gc polymorphism was revealed in the Khalkhas sheep of Mongolia, consisting of F, S and W variants, and the Yunnan native sheep of China, consisting of F and S variants. In particular, W was a new variant. The V variant detected in European sheep up to now was not observed in these sheep. The Bhyanglung, Baruwal, Kagi and Lampuchhre sheep of Nepal and local sheep of Bangladesh and Vietnam were monomorphic for the S variant. Family data and population genetic data supported the hypothesis that these variants were controlled by codominant alleles. In these Asian sheep, distribution of the $Gc^s$ allele was predominant (0.9571-1) and was seen as well in European sheep (Suffolk, Corriedale, Cheviot and Finnish Landrace) raised in Japan. $Gc^w$ allele was detected only in the Khalkhas sheep with the low frequency of 0.0025. The $Gc^v$ allele was detected in the Suffolk and Corriedale sheep (0.0080 and 0.0682), but not in any of the Asian sheep studied.

  • Our nation has experienced remarkable growth over the half a century. Nonetheless, there is still much room for improvement in the area of Environment, Health and Safety (EHS). In particular, frequency and severity of industrial accidents did not considerably improve compared to the economic and social progress we made. The main objective of this research is to analyze what plans and actions are required for companies to promote industrial safety by 1) fostering functional competencies of EHS staffs and 2) effectively and proactively responding to rapidly changing EHS environment. For this research, EHS staffs from five large companies in Korea were surveyed. Most respondents indicated that one of key expertise required by EHS staffs is capabilities to effectively deal with changes to various domestic and international EHS-related laws and regulations. Furthermore, a predominant number of respondents commented that it is imperative for EHS staffs to have a broad knowledge of business management. As for internal issues that EHS staffs encounter within their organizations, many pointed out that their EHS vision is not sufficiently shared throughout the organization, and that the rules of leadership are critical in solving this issue. On the other hand, the survey respondents also raised an issue of limited EHS-related investments due to slow economy. As a solution, they proposed ways to align EHS organization's performance with the company's performance. Based on this survey, issues and solutions for EHS organizations were identified. Results of this research can benefit companies that plan to newly establish or further expand EHS organization.

  • Spontaneous myometrial contraction (SMC) in pregnant uterus is greatly related with gestational age and growing in frequency and amplitude toward the end of gestation to initiate labor. But, an accurate mechanism has not been elucidated. In human and rat uterus, all TRPCs except TRPC2 are expressed in pregnant myometrium and among them, TRPC4 are predominant throughout gestation, suggesting a possible role in regulation of SMC. Therefore, we investigated whether the TRP channel may be involved SMC evoked by mechanical stretch in pregnant myometrial strips of rat using isometric tension measurement and patch-clamp technique. In the present results, hypoosmotic cell swelling activated a potent outward rectifying current in G protein-dependent manner in rat pregnant myocyte. The current was significantly potentiated by $1{\mu}M$ lanthanides (a potent TRPC4/5 stimulator) and suppressed by $10{\mu}M$ 2-APB (TRPC4-7 inhibitor). In addition, in isometric tension experiment, SMC which was evoked by passive stretch was greatly potentiated by lanthanide ($1{\mu}M$) and suppressed by 2-APB ($10{\mu}M$), suggesting a possible involvement of TRPC4/5 channel in regulation of SMC in pregnant myometrium. These results provide a possible cellular mechanism for regulation of SMC during pregnancy and provide basic information for developing a new agent for treatment of premature labor.

  • Speech recognition is now one of the most widely used technologies in HCI. Many applications where speech recognition may be used (such as home automation, automatic speech translation, and car navigation) are now under active development. In addition, the demand for speech recognition systems in mobile environments is rapidly increasing. This paper is intended to present a method for instant recognition of the Korean vowel 'ㅡ', as a part of a Korean speech recognition system. The proposed method uses bulk indicators (which are calculated in the time domain) instead of the frequency domain and consequently, the computational cost for the recognition can be reduced. The bulk indicators representing predominant sequence patterns of the vowel 'ㅡ' are learned by neural networks and final recognition decisions are made by those trained neural networks. The results of the experiment show that the proposed method can achieve 88.7% recognition accuracy, and recognition speed of 0.74 msec per syllable.

  • Twelve species of fungi were isolated from rice straw media for oyster mushroom cultivation. Trichoderma, Aspergillus and Rhizopus were the predominant fungi. Seven species of Trichoderma were isolated and identified from the rice straw media and the order of their frequency in the media was pseudokonigii, aureoviride, viride, harzianum and koningii. Occurrence of harmful fungi in mushroom houses become more severe as the number of cultivation times increased, and that was more severe in spring culture than in autumn culture. Mycelial growth and sporulation of Trichoderma, Aspergillus and Rhizopus were fovorable on the media appended with extracts of rice straws and oyster mushrooms. This results indicate that the rice straw media and mushrooms give favorable conditions for the occurrence of the fungi in the mushroom houses. Mycelial growth of Trichoderma spp. was favorable on saw­dust extraction media and rice bran extraction media, and the spawns inoculated at the mushroom beds present media of the fungi.

  • This paper proposes an optimal design method for the nonlinear seismic isolated bridge. The probabilities of failure at the pier and the seismic isolator are considered as objective functions for optimal design, and a multi-objective optimization technique is employed to efficiently explore a set of multiple solutions optimizing mutually-conflicting objective functions at the same time. In addition, a stochastic linearization method is incorporated into the multi-objective optimization framework in order to effectively estimate the stochastic responses of the bridge without performing numerous nonlinear time history analyses during the optimization process. As a numerical example to demonstrate the efficiency of the proposed method, the Nam-Han river bridge is taken into account, and the proposed method and the existing life-cycle-cost based design method are both applied for the purpose of comparing their seismic performances. The comparative results demonstrate that the proposed method not only shows better seismic performance but also is more economical than the existing cost-based design method. The proposed method is also proven to guarantee improved performance under variations in seismic intensity, in bandwidth and in the predominant frequency of the seismic event.

  • Purpose: The purpose of this study was to examine the prevalence and risk factors of suicidal ideation among middle class Korean. Methods: Cross sectional study was designed for secondary data analysis. From the 8th Korea Health Panel survey (2008~2013), a total of 6,037 data was drawn and analyzed by developmental stage using descriptive statistics including frequency, percentage, $x^2$ test, and logistic regression analysis. Results: Across all age groups, high physical-mental stress, frustration, anxiety about the future and low self-perceived health status or social class were found to be the risk factors of suicidal ideation. Peer-compared subjective health status and frustration significantly influenced the adolescents. The young adults'suicidal ideation was mainly influenced by physical and mental stress, frustration and absence of economic activity. For the middle-aged, physical and mental stress, frustration, future anxiety, low peer-compared subjective health status were found to be the major influencing factors. The predominant risk factors for the elderly were frustration and low peer-compared subjective health status. Conclusion: Making comparisons to others significantly influence suicidal ideation throughout all life cycles. Improvement of mental health and suicide prevention can be enhanced by avoiding negative comparison to others.
